I have one of these.  Works great with my PERSTOR controller, giving 115Meg
using only the first 1024 cylinders.. another 15 Meg if I use the rest.

Here's what spedstor says about it for MFM use:

               P r i a m / V e r t e x   D r i v e   M o d e l s
    ModelName   Cylinders  Heads  Sectors  PreComp  LandingZone   TotalBytes

     V185-        1024       7      17      none       1023       62,390,272
     V185         1166       7      17      none       1165       71,042,048

The V185- refers to "using only the first 1024 cylinders" for compatibility
without adding a driver that supports more.
